📌 CONCEPT: The slope of two perpendicular lines is the negative reciprocal of each other, which means if one line has a slope 'm', the other line will have a slope of -1/m.
📐 RULE / FORMULA: The product of the slopes of two perpendicular lines is -1, i.e., m1 * m2 = -1.
